Job Description

The Company

Black Cat Civil are a fast-growing, Australian Indigenous-owned civil contractor, specializing in the delivery of remote and regional infrastructure projects throughout Queensland and the Northern Territory. Since our humble beginnings on the Sunshine Coast in 2006, Black Cat Civil has now grown to over 290 employees, 450 pieces of plant, and over 1800 completed projects, across sites in QLD, the NT, and beyond.

About the Role

Black Cat Civil are currently seeking experienced Diesel Fitters for a broad range of positions in the business, across Australia.

Emerald Based - No flights or accommodation provided

7/7 Roster - Dayshift only

Successful candidates will be responsible for servicing, maintenance and repairs of various mobile equipment that is performing critical works in some of Australia’s most iconic locations.

Key Responsibilities:

  • Perform on-site servicing, preventative maintenance, and repairs to mobile plant, including heavy earth-moving equipment, trucks, generators, and light vehicles.
  • Prepare new machines to site specification requirements.
  • Troubleshoot and diagnose mechanical faults and attend machine breakdowns on site.
  • Liaise with the Fleet Manager and/or Workshop Supervisor to diagnose faults and coordinate parts.
  • Major engine and component rebuilds.

Candidate Skills & Experience:

  • Relevant Trade Qualification in Diesel Fitting, or equivalent
  • 2+ years fitting experience, preferably on heavy earth-moving equipment
  • Extensive experience working with Caterpillar equipment highly regarded
  • Field service experience
  • Experience working with hydraulics
  • Strong focus on safety and quality
  • Open to working locally.
  • Aircon ticket and heavy vehicle driver’s licence highly regarded.
  • Reliable and a team player

About Black Cat Civil Pty Ltd

Black Cat Civil has been operating in the civil, rail, mining and construction industries since 2006. Black Cat Civil is an indigenous owned company with operations throughout Queensland, the Northern Territory and New South Wales.

Originally founded as Black Cat Queensland by Jai Tomlinson and Brendan Flynn, the company has grown to become a leader in supplying plant hire and contract works to the civil, rail, mining and construction industries.

The company embraces new technologies throughout its Caterpillar fleet of earthmoving equipment We are well equipped and staffed to mobilise and complete any size and complexity of projects.

Black Cat Civil holds accreditation from the Federal Safety Commissioner and has safety, environment and quality ISO certification.
